Pinpoint Test D: The Roof Opening Panel Is Noisy During Operation
W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2010 Mercury Mariner and 2010 Ford Escape.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
- D1 CHECK THE ROOF OPENING PANEL GLASS FOR OBSTRUCTIONS OR DAMAGE
- Check the roof opening panel glass for any obstructions or damage from the following:
- sand.
- dirt.
- leaves.
- Are there any obstructions or damage?
- Yes: REMOVE all obstructions. REPAIR the roof opening panel as necessary. TEST the system for normal operation.
- No: GO to D2 .

- D2 CHECK THE ROOF OPENING PANEL GLASS OPERATION
- Check the roof opening panel glass during operation.
- Is the roof opening panel glass loose or not correctly aligned?
- Yes: ALIGN the roof opening panel. REFER to ROOF OPENING PANEL ALIGNMENT . VERIFY all bolts are tightened to specification. TEST the system for normal operation.
- No: GO to D3 .
- D3 CHECK THE ROOF OPENING PANEL TRACKS
- Open the roof opening panel glass.
- Check the tracks for obstructions or signs of damage.
- Are the tracks OK?
- Yes: GO to D4 .
- No: REMOVE all obstructions. REPAIR any damage as necessary. TEST the system for normal operation.
- D4 CHECK THE ROOF OPENING PANEL SHIELD
- Check the roof opening panel shield for correct movement.
- Is the shield moving correctly?
- Yes: GO to D5 .
- No: REPAIR or INSTALL a new roof opening panel shield. REFER to ROOF OPENING PANEL SHIELD . TEST the system for normal operation.
- D5 CHECK THE ROOF OPENING PANEL MOTOR
- Gain access to the roof opening panel motor.
- Open the roof opening panel.
- Does the motor make excessive noise?
- Yes: INSTALL a new roof opening panel motor. REFER to ROOF OPENING PANEL MOTOR . TEST the system for normal operation.
- No: ALIGN the roof opening panel glass. REFER to ROOF OPENING PANEL ALIGNMENT . TEST the system for normal operation.
